Harvesting tips

Mature celery stalks with reach 18 - 20" with lime green foliage and long, smooth, broad stalks. Harvest individual celery stalks as needed or harvest the entire plant when it reached a mature size.

Cool stalks immediately after harvesting by placing them in water. If freshly harvested celery is bitter then you should store it in the fridge just above freezing for a few days in to improve flavor!
